Medical Records Coding Technician jobs in O Fallon, MO

Medical Records Coding Technician abstracts clinical information from medical records and assigns the appropriate ICD or CPT codes using industry-standard coding guidelines. Assigns required DRG (diagnosis-related grouping) codes. Being a Medical Records Coding Technician works with coding databases and software to input and maintain data according to standard procedures. Performs quality audits of work. Additionally, Medical Records Coding Technician maintains and up-to-date knowledge of coding and documentation requirements. Requires a medical coding certification. The exact type of coding certification may vary based on the clinical setting or a medical specialty focus. May require an associate degree. The AAPC Certified Professional Coder (CPC) certification is typically required. The Certified Coding Specialist (CCS) certification is also a typical requirement.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Medical Records Coding Technician works independently within established procedures associated with the specific job function. Has gained proficiency in multiple competencies relevant to the job. To be a Medical Records Coding Technician typically requires 3-5 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Medical Records Technician II
  • TOUCHETTE
  • Centreville, IL FULL_TIME
  • Job Summary:

    Maintains and monitors medical record integrity through record organization and management, filing, assembly, analysis and re-analysis (updates), final check retrieval, record control, completion, scanning, index, quality review and overall processing and accounting for any/all patient health information (medical records). Assisting if necessary with charge entry, meaningful use, and release of information functions and other phone and clerical duties within the Health Information Department while maintains HIPAA compliance, confidentiality and security of the patients’ records

    Functions and Duties:

    • Verification of receipt any/all records and reports to HIS Department per applicable lists identifying patients registered and subsequently receiving service.
    • Follow up of any/all records and reports not received in HIS Department.
    • Assigns facility fee Evaluation and Management (E/M) charges to Emergency Department records based on nursing and hospital resources used to treat the patient.
    • Completes facility fee charging within 24 business hours from date of discharge.
    • Prepares sorts, analyze, prep, scan, index and quality review records per established chart order and document type and for completeness the medical records of patients discharged.
    • Performs quantitative analysis of each chart and analysis.
    • Performs qualitative analysis and final check to identify missing documentation, misfiled information, and /or information and follows up to secure receipt appropriately.
    • Performs re-analysis and final check processes of all records until achieve completion status required to route to Permanent File area and updates automated incomplete record system appropriate.
    • Understanding of medical terminology and hospital procedures including lab, x-ray and diagnostic services.
    • Understands working relationships between nursing, advanced practitioners and ER attending on record.
    • Assist with outside correspondence phone calls, and record pulls needed for correspondence while maintaining a 15-day turn-around.
    • Actively participates with the scanning and assignment of a deficiency for the coding query to physicians.
    • Notes deficiencies to be completed by physician or other professional staff.
    • Organizes work time to complete assigned tasks on time.
    • Maintains close working relationship with ancillary departments in carrying out medical record functions.
    • Communicates clearly and accurately by phone, fax, or email.
    • Maintains confidentiality of patients’ records and safeguards privacy of medical record information.
    • Performs duties with minimum supervision and uses work time productively.
    • Process requests per established ROI/HIPAA/Meaningful use procedures.
    • Knowledge and assistance of how to retrieve and print ambulance reports daily.
    • Daily completion and maintenance of Index Utility Queue.
    • Performs all other duties as assigned.

    Minimum Qualifications:

    Education

    • High school diploma or GED equivalent required.
    • Associates degree, preferred.

    Experience

    • Minimum of 5 years work related medical record experience, preferred.

    Certifications, Licenses, and Registrations

    • RHIT (Registered Health Information Technician) or eligible, preferred.

    Skills and Abilities

    • Working knowledge and/or familiarization with computer software (Microsoft Office Applications) and office equipment (copier, calculator, etc).
    • Medical terminology.
    • Hospital billing and chargemaster experience, preferred.

O'Fallon /oʊˈfælən/ is a city along Interstate 64 and Interstate 70 between Lake St. Louis and St. Peters in St. Charles County, Missouri, United States. It is part of the St. Louis Metropolitan Statistical Area. As of the 2010 census O'Fallon had a population of 79,329, making it the largest municipality in St. Charles County and seventh largest in the state of Missouri. O'Fallon's namesake in St. Clair County, Illinois is also part of the St. Louis Metropolitan Statistical Area.
